Nigelw Posted October 23, 2013 Share Posted October 23, 2013 Have been asked to help a friend out with his Disco, the thing is he cut the door pillar away to fit H/D box section sills, but he didn't brace the pillar before welding it up and now the door gap is major bad, he has had to adjust the door pin out over a centimeter to get it closed. What is the easiest way to get it back in place?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
landroversforever Posted October 23, 2013 Share Posted October 23, 2013 If it's that far out, cut and reweld I think.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Maverik Posted October 23, 2013 Share Posted October 23, 2013 As per what ross said... I think there's a lesson to be learned here...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Bowie69 Posted October 23, 2013 Share Posted October 23, 2013 Yup, shut the door before re-welding, tack in place, open, close, fully weld, done.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Nigelw Posted October 23, 2013 Author Share Posted October 23, 2013 Thankfully not my handy work for once But out of pity I took an afternoon off my own project to go and help/advise. It was a case of getting pi55 wet through and cutting it out and getting creative with some thread rod and some off cuts of angle. it was about 14mm out forward and the the door wouldn't shut, but it had also dropped by 20mm too , guess who has been commissioned to do the other side now then Getting busy in my bushmans workshop.
